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Allen’s Common Mustached Bat | علجوم مغاربي |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(حيوانات) | Animalia (حيوانات)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(حبليات) | Chordata (حبليات) |
| Class | Mammalia (ثدييات) | Amphibia (برمائيات) |
| Order | Chiroptera (خفاشيات) | Anura (ضفدع) |
| Family | Mormoopidae | Bufonidae |
| Genus | Pteronotus | Sclerophrys |
| Species | Pteronotus fuscus | Sclerophrys mauritanica |
Evolutionary Relationship
Allen’s Common Mustached Bat and علجوم مغاربي share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(حبليات)

Allen’s Common Mustached Bat
The Allen’s Common Mustached Bat (Pteronotus fuscus) is a species in the genus Pteronotus.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Typically found in diverse terrestrial and aquatic ecosystems.
علجوم مغاربي
The Berber Toad (Sclerophrys mauritanica) is a species in the genus Sclerophrys.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Typically found in freshwater habitats, moist forests, and wetlands.
